Health permitting, Brock Lesnar vs. Cain Velasquez could be UFC 119 headliner
by MMAjunkie.com Staff on Jul 05, 2010 at 8:55 am ET
UFC 119 could have a major championship headliner.

Following his UFC 116 title-unification victory over interim champion Shane Carwin, undisputed heavyweight champ Brock Lesnar (5-1 MMA, 4-1 UFC) now could meet top contender Cain Velasquez (8-0 MMA, 6-0 UFC) in the main event of September's UFC 119 event.

Prior to Saturday's event at the M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as, Lesnar and Carwin both were told by UFC officials that the winner – health permitting – tentatively would meet Velasquez at UFC 119. That's according to a report from MMAjunkie.com's (www.mmajunkie.com) Dann Stupp in his weekly Dayton Daily News "MMA Insider" column.

Although not officially announced by the organization, UFC 119 takes place Sept. 25 at Conseco Fieldhouse in Indianapolis.

Lesnar's team and UFC officials are expected to discuss the possibility of the UFC 119 slot this week.

Lesnar suffered some damage in a first round dominated by Carwin's ground and pound. In fact, two judges award him the round via scores of 10-8. However, he recovered in the second and secured an via arm-triangle choke to submit Carwin. Lesnar attended the night's post-fight conference and suggested he had no serious injuries, which makes a potential UFC 119 meeting a real possibility.

UFC 119, of course, is in desperate need of a main event. With the organization's busy late-summer/fall schedule, few top draws and headline-worthy fighters are available for the event, which marks the UFC's debut in the state of Indiana.

Lesnar certainly would give the show a boost. His fight with Carwin is likely to produce approximately 1 million pay-per-view buys, according to UFC president Dana White, and many consider the former WWE star the world's new top-ranked heavyweight following former kingpin Fedor Emelianenko's recent loss to Strikeforce fighter Fabricio Werdum.

After UFC 116, White confirmed the UFC's plans to give Velasquez the next title shot. The undefeated American Kickboxing Academy fighter earned his title shot with six consecutive UFC victories, including back-to-back knockouts of contender Cheick Kongo and former title-holder Antonio Rodrigo Nogueira.

A welterweight rematch between Chris Lytle (29-17-5 MMA, 8-9 UFC) and Matt Serra (11-6 MMA, 7-6 UFC) will be featured on the main card of the as-yet-unannounced UFC 119 event.

MMAjunkie.com (www.mmajunkie.com) has learned from sources close to the promotion that both fighters have agreed to the matchup, and bout agreements are expected to be finalized shortly.

UFC 119 takes place Sept. 25 at Conseco Fieldhouse in Indianapolis.

The two longtime UFC veterans first met at The Ultimate Fighter 4 Finale in November 2006 following the lone season of the Spike TV-broadcast reality series to feature organization veterans. Serra earned a split-decision nod in the fight.

Serra, of course, earned a title shot with the win over Lytle and went on to shock the MMA world with a first-round TKO of Georges St-Pierre. Serra was crowned the UFC's welterweight champion with the win, though he would relinquish the belt to St-Pierre in a rematch at UFC 83.

Serra fought most recently in a UFC 109 TKO win over Frank Trigg.

Meanwhile, Lytle carries a three-fight win streak into the matchup – his longest such run to take place in the octagon. An Indianapolis native, Lytle fought at this past weekend's UFC 116 event, where he made a claim for the evening's "Submission of the Night" with a combination triangle choke/straight armbar finish of Matt Brown. That claim ultimately fell short when UFC heavyweight champion Brock Lesnar tapped out then-interim champ Shane Carwin.

Despite the snub, Lytle's go-for-broke fighting style has earned him an astounding seven "Fight Night" bonuses in his past nine UFC fights.
